A REPUBLICAN SOCIETY IN PORTUGAL Lisbon December 28th.-The discovery of a Republican Society among the Military officers here has created ja widespread ex citement and the grand coronation review tras consequently postponed.

BUĽIAL OF MR BROWNING.
London, Dec. 31as. The remains of the late Mr Browning were interred to-day in Nino men of eminence in letters and art Westminster Abbig, which was crowded,
acted as pall-bearers, and unmercus celebrities were amongst the congregation,

London, Dea. Slet.--The Channel Squadron is proceeding to Gibraltar.
The Calliope has been stopped on the way honnu in the Canal, and ordered to proceed to Aden, ber ultimate destination probably being Delagon Bay. Lord, Salisbury Las completed his final answer to Portugal. The silence of Mr. Johnson, the British

remia indoors for a fortnight, as the pos- sibility of pneumonia supervening is feared. London, January 2nd. The nursing bul- lotin regarding the health of Lord Salisbary announces that His Lordship is not yet in a condition which will allow him to leave his bod. His Lordship has passed the worst stage of the malady, and, therefore, there is no reason to apprehend any serious consequences,
The period of convalescones
London, January 6th - Lord Salisbury
will probably be a protracted one:
making good progress towards recovery

Lawn Tennis match e. Straits Bottlemonts will take place to-morrow, at 4 p.m., on the Cricket Ground. Hongkong will be re- presented by Messrs E. J. Coxon and W. H. Wallace, and Singapore by Mesers Braddell and Birch,
